Hey guys! I have a fun pattern for you today - I’m calling it the snake pattern and it is made using half hitches. Let’s get started.

Set up - cut 2 pieces of rope, each piece is approx. 2 meters long. Please keep in mind that I had some cord leftover after completing this pattern. A helpful tip when measuring out your cord lengths - for this pattern the two outside cords will be used as your working cords and will use more rope that the two filler cords in the middle. Fold the two cords in half and attach them to your work using Lark’s Head knots.

Using the cord on the left tie 4 half hitches around the two middle cords. Repeat on the right side of your work. Continue this pattern to create your desired length.
